Popular Ebooks and Audiobooks Keep Students Reading All Summer Long

eSchool News

From May 4 through August 17, students from participating schools worldwide can enjoy free, 24/7 access through the Sora reading app to 50 juvenile and young adult ebooks, audiobooks and Read-Alongs from their school, the largest amount ever offered through the program. Audiobook titles include Flannery and Game Changer. See the full list.

Amazon wins $30M contract to sell e-books to NYC schools

eSchool News

The e-books will be readable on e-readers, tablets, smartphones, laptops and other devices. In its bid for NYC’s business, Amazon edged out competitor OverDrive, which is also ramping up its commitment to schools and school libraries to compete for districts’ e-book dollars. million in the first year of the contract.
